The role:

SoFi Invest drives the strategy, planning and execution of initiatives for the Brokerage. We’re seeking a Junior Business Lead to join SoFi’s Invest Business Team. The Invest Business Team is responsible for helping SoFi’s Members with all steps in their investment journey.

In this role, you will become a trusted member of the Invest Business Team and will gain exposure to high-impact strategic projects and continue to build out expertise in the brokerage and investing arena. You will be expected to collaborate with partners in a matrix-environment with a focus on improving efficiencies in the way we run our business.

What you’ll do:

  • Support the Brokerage Business Lead with strategic initiatives across the brokerage and advisory space
  • Work cross-functionally across multiple groups including Data Science, Engineering, Product, Design, Compliance and Marketing
  • Develop into a subject matter expert around equities, options, mutual funds and other investing products
  • Keep abreast of trends and competitors in the Fintech area and be able to articulate how the trends impact the business
  • Assist with oversight functions such as monthly reporting, validating controls and responding to regulatory requests
  • Complete ad hoc analysis to further understand how members use our products and platforms
  • Perform basic financial analysis to assist with business cases and product metrics
  • Manage 3rd party relationships with suppliers

What you’ll need:

  • Passion for our mission of helping people achieve their financial goals
  • Understanding of the brokerage and trading industry and investment products or willingness to learn
  • 3-5 years of experience in a consulting firm, brokerage/trading firm or exchanges
  • Understanding of trading platforms is a plus
  • Strong analytical abilities (SoFi is a data-driven company) and proficiency with Excel/Google Sheets, Powerpoint/Google Slides,
  • Proficiency in SQL and Tableau will be highly preferred or willingness to learn
  • A clear communicator with exc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Excellent time and project management skills with the ability to build strong cross-functional relationships and work collaboratively
  • Ability to work independently and a strong sense of ownership (Methodical, self-starter, hands-on, willingness to get into the details)
  • Inquisitive nature, attention to detail, diligence and a good attitude
